Once upon a time, in a cozy cottage at the edge of a deep forest, lived a curious little girl named Goldilocks. One sunny morning, while exploring the woods, she stumbled upon a charming wooden house. “I wonder who lives here?” she thought. Finding the door slightly ajar, she gently pushed it open and stepped inside.

Inside, she discovered three bowls of steaming porridge on the kitchen table. “Hmm, that smells delicious!” she said. She tried the biggest bowl, but it was too hot. The middle bowl was too cold. The smallest bowl was just right—and she ate every last spoonful!

Next, she noticed three chairs in the living room. The largest chair felt too hard, the middle chair was too wobbly, but the tiny chair was just right. She bounced up and down in excitement—until the little chair snap! broke into pieces.

Feeling sleepy after her adventures, Goldilocks climbed the creaky stairs to find three beds. The first bed was too firm, the second was too soft, but the third bed was just right. She snuggled in and fell fast asleep.

While she slept, the house’s owners returned—the Papa Bear, Mama Bear, and Baby Bear! “Someone’s been eating my porridge!” growled Papa. “Someone’s been sitting in my chair!” huffed Mama. “Someone’s been sleeping in my bed—and she’s still there!” squeaked Baby Bear.

Goldilocks awoke with a start and, with a scream, fled through the window, running all the way back to her own home. She never visited the bear family again—but she learned a valuable lesson about respecting others’ belongings.

Moral: Always ask permission before using someone else’s things—it’s the golden rule of kindness! 🐻✨
